Well my wife thinks her 02 Tahoe (5.3L flex) should have more power. I think it runs fine but don't know when the plugs and wire set were changed last so I said okay.

got a new set of wires ( thought it was great all eight wires are the same!!!) and installed Bosche Platinum +2. it ran terrible got a service engine soon and a p0300 code also. kept reseating the wires thinking I was getting spark leak. Finally replaced the plugs with Bosche Platinum +4, runs as good as ever. Not sure what was wrong with the first set of plugs maybe the electrodes were bent too close. thought I would just share.

FYI I have used the Platinum+4 in my ford ranger and really like them.

Have seen lots of trouble with Bosch plugs in these engines.
I recommend either the OEM AC Delco's or NGK's Iridium or IX Iridium plugs in your 5.3L
